How much is the Alcorn State tuition? For the academic year 2023-2024, Alcorn State's tuition & fees is $8,549.
With indirect costs not billed by school, such as room & boards and personal living expenses, the total cost of attendance for one academic year is $23,744 when a student lives on-campus.

How Much Does it Cost to Go to Alcorn State for 4 Years?
For the class of 2027, who entering colleges in 2023, the 4 years tuition & fees is $34,196 at Alcorn State. The estimated tuition rate is based on the changes over last 5 years. With room & board, books, and other personal expenses, the estimated 4 years costs of attendance is $83,575. After receiving financial aid including grants, scholarships, and/or student loans, the 4 years COA is down to $43,275.

Tuition Trends Over Past 10 Years
The undergraduate tuition & fees of Alcorn State University has increased by 39.96% over the past 10 years from $6,108 to $8,549. The graduate tuition & fee has increased by 44.96% from $6,108 to $9,263.
The living costs increased by -3.61% last year and 1.01% over the past 10 years.
Financial Aid and COA
At Alcorn State University, 2,321 students (92%) received grant or scholarship from the federal government, state or local government, the institution, and other sources. The average amount of grant/scholarship received is $10,075.
After receiving financial aid, the cost of attendance (COA) at Alcorn State is $13,669 for students living on-campus and $16,819 for students living off-campus.
For beginning students (i.e. first-time freshmen), 393 students received any type of financial aid including grants/scholarship and student loans. The average amount of grant/scholarship for the first-time students is $10,386 and the average amount of student loans is $6,039.
The financial aid data is based on 2021-2022 statistics from IPEDS.
Admission Stats and Requirements to Apply
Alcorn State's acceptance rate is 38.91%. A total of 4,819 applicants applied to and 1,875 students were accepted. Of the admitted students, 402 enrolled finally, and the yield (i.e. enrollment rate) is 21.44%.
To apply to Alcorn State, 4 items are required - Secondary school GPA, Secondary school record, Admission test scores and TOEFL (Test of English as a Foreign Language) and 1 items are recommended to submit - Secondary school rank.
SAT and ACT Scores
The SAT and ACT scores are required to apply to Alcorn State. The average SAT score of the enrolled first-time students is 963 and the average ACT score (ACT composite) is 22.
Its SAT score is lower than the national average score of 1,168. The ACT score is lower than the national average score of 24.

Student Population
Alcorn State University has a total of 2,933 students including 2,431 undergraduate and 502 graduate students. By gender, there are 985 male students and 2,089 female students attending Alcorn State. The school offers online degree programs and 599 students enrolled online exclusively (20.42% of all students).
